Job Description

Job Summary We are seeking an experienced and energetic Private Lesson Instructor specializing in Violin, Piano, or Voice to inspire and nurture students of all ages and skill levels. In this role, you will deliver personalized, engaging lessons that foster musical growth, confidence, and creativity. Your enthusiasm and expertise will help students develop their technical skills, musicality, and love for the arts in a supportive learning environment. This paid position offers an exciting opportunity to make a meaningful impact on students' musical journeys while honing your teaching craft. Responsibilities Design and deliver customized private lessons tailored to each student's age, skill level, and musical interests Develop comprehensive curricula that incorporate technical exercises, repertoire selection, and performance preparation Create a positive, motivating atmosphere that encourages student engagement and confidence-building Assess student progress regularly and provide constructive feedback to support continuous improvement Manage lesson planning logistics, including scheduling, lesson documentation, and progress tracking Adapt teaching methods to accommodate diverse learning styles and special educational needs Foster a safe, respectful environment that promotes discipline, creativity, and enjoyment of music Skills Strong background in violin, piano or voice performance with professional training or equivalent experience Proven ability to develop effective curriculum plans aligned with student goals and abilities Excellent teaching skills with experience working with children, teens, or adults in educational settings Classroom management skills to maintain focus and discipline during lessons Experience tutoring students of varying ages and skill levels in music education Knowledge of childhood development principles and early childhood education practices Ability to incorporate additional skills such as photography, ballet, cooking, theater or sewing into creative lesson plans is a plus Familiarity with behavior management techniques to support positive learning experiences Experience working with special education needs or early childhood education is advantageous Join us in shaping the next generation of musicians by providing inspiring lessons that ignite passion and unlock potential.
